In 1918, Hardy and Ramanujan wrote their landmark paper deriving the asymptotic formula for the partition function. The paper however was fundamental for another reason, namely for introducing the circle method in questions of additive number theory. متن کاملOn Stanley's Partition Function
Stanley defined a partition function t(n) as the number of partitions λ of n such that the number of odd parts of λ is congruent to the number of odd parts of the conjugate partition λ modulo 4. We show that t(n) equals the number of partitions of n with an even number of hooks of even length. We derive a closed-form formula for the generating function for the numbers p(n)− t(n).
